Chapter 84: Nightmare City 20

 

In the live streaming room, the dazzling and incessant comments suddenly paused for a moment, and then rolled and surged with even more frenzied tendencies.

 

“What’s going on? What exactly happened, was someone assassinated?”

 

“I don’t know, all the cameras are focused on the Emperor, the gunshot came from somewhere else.”

 

“Holy shit, are you still discussing this, didn’t you see what the Emperor did?”

 

“The Emperor is formidable! Ordinary people can’t do such things.”

 

“I thought they would… Turns out I’m still too young, oh no, I can already see the Emperor not finding a partner for the next ten years.”

 

“Wow, from this angle, this bird’s-eye view, let me take a screenshot first.”

 

“Hahaha, too awesome, the Emperor dodged so quickly, I’m already laughing until my face is twitching.”

 

“He looks so handsome, couldn’t the Emperor at least help him up, instead of dodging and even moving the chair away?”

 

“What does being handsome have to do with it, clearly he deliberately fell onto the Emperor, how could he be the only one with weak legs?”

 

“……with the Emperor’s personality, when will we have an Empress?”

 

The masses on the Stellar Network were discussing animatedly, while not far from Alvia, Ryan was walking quickly towards the direction where the gunshot had sounded, his mouth slightly twitching, as if he wanted to laugh but was holding it back with great effort.

 

At the same time as the singer pounced towards Alvia, Alvia made an unexpected move that no one could have imagined.

 

He swiftly dodged to the side, even moving the chair behind him, and just like that, the frail little singer fell directly to the ground, with no tools around to support his balance. Alvia simply placed one hand on the chair, coldly watching him fall to the ground.

 

He even frowned slightly, looking at the person who had been terrified by a single gunshot, his expression revealing obvious displeasure.

 

The singer who had fallen to the ground was still a little dazed, slowly sitting up from the floor. As soon as he looked up, he saw Alvia’s cold gaze fixed on him.

 

Embarrassment and shame immediately surged in his heart. The singer’s face instantly turned red.

 

“I’m sorry!” The singer immediately stood up from the ground, apologizing in a flustered manner, while picking up the feathered accessory that had fallen to the ground, intending to return it to Alvia.

 

By this time, Alvia had turned his head away, no longer looking at him, but towards the direction where the gunshot had come from.

 

The singer’s fall had been too eye-catching, and hardly anyone had paid attention to the source of the incident, the gunshot that had rung out during the founding ceremony.

 

Other members of the guard squad were also heading towards the direction of the nobles after the gunshot sounded. The gunshot had come without any warning, and it was unknown where exactly it had originated from or whether anyone had been injured.

 

In the live broadcast, apart from discussing the fallen singer and the Emperor’s reaction, people were now gradually starting to ask what the gunshot was all about.

 

Most of the guards around Alvia had walked away, and the next group of performers below the stage were also nervously watching this side, even though it was almost their turn to perform, this had happened.

 

The nobles closest to the gunshot were frantically fleeing in all directions, clutching their heads. The scene was in chaos, and it was impossible to tell who had fired the shot or whether anyone had been injured.

 

However, there were still some nobles with more experience sitting in their original positions, warily watching their surroundings, and not fleeing in panic like the others.

 

“It’s Duke Xelance.” Ryan frowned as he spoke.

 

A nobleman in his fifties, and one of Alvia’s most loyal supporters, was sitting in his seat with his head slightly lowered, looking as if he had fallen asleep, but fresh blood was continuously seeping from his chest.

 

It seemed that the assassination had been aimed at him.

 

The guard squad and medical team were in the area where the nobles were seated, while also searching for the source of the gunshot. Apart from a terrified singer still persistently holding up the feathered accessory, there was no one protecting Alvia.

 

“Your Majesty, Your Majesty, this is for you.”

 

Alvia glanced at the feathered accessory but did not speak. All his attention seemed to be focused on the nobles’ area, and he did not want to bother with the person in front of him.

 

Sensing that Alvia seemed to want to bypass him and go to the nobles’ area, the singer, who was lowering his head respectfully, gritted his teeth, and his fingers moved slightly.

 

A red beam of light suddenly appeared from the singer’s wrist, and in the blink of an eye, it was about to pierce through Alvia’s chest.

 

A foul odor of burnt feathers spread, and the blackened feathers fell to the ground once more. The red beam struck Alvia directly.

 

The singer’s entire body was trembling, but his eyes were wide open with excitement. He had succeeded! He had actually killed the Emperor during the founding ceremony.

 

But the next second, he suddenly realized something was amiss. Where was the blood? The smell of a body being pierced by a laser beam?

 

He looked up in surprise, only to see Alvia’s calm, indifferent eyes gazing at him, neither angry nor surprised, as if he were an insignificant character.

 

Lowering his gaze, he saw that the red laser had not pierced through Alvia at all. Alvia’s entire body was enveloped in a transparent, thin membrane, and the laser had fallen upon that membrane, unable to continue forward, let alone kill Alvia.

 

What was this thing? Why could it block lasers?

 

The singer trembled, his instincts telling him he should flee immediately, but his body was not under his control, as if rooted to the spot.

 

Alvia kicked him away with one foot, and the seemingly frail singer was knocked to the ground. The laser from his wrist had not been turned off, and as the singer fell, the hard ground was instantly cut open with a deep, long gash.

 

His chest in so much pain that he could not breathe, the singer coughed up a mouthful of blood, his face pale as he clutched at his chest, wanting to say something but finding it extremely difficult even to breathe.

 

“Your Majesty!”

 

The guards seemed to have only just reacted, rushing towards Alvia’s direction.

 

No sooner had one wave subsided than another arose. The performers below the stage suddenly erupted, aiming their props, which had been checked over repeatedly and deemed safe enough to be brought here, towards Alvia. These props had transformed into various weapons firing directly at Alvia not far away on the stage.

 

The stage above was instantly blown apart by the powerful weapons, countless debris and smoke rising, obscuring the black figure from view.

 

Almost no one in the live streaming room was speaking, as people anxiously watched the smoke-filled area in the video. What was going on? How was the Emperor?

 

The disguised props-turned-weapons continued their assault, and the once pristine stage was now riddled with craters and pockmarks from the bombardment. Even the singer who had been kicked to the ground but was still alive moments ago, was now unrecognizable, completely disfigured by the same indiscriminate attacks that had moments earlier revealed his sacred appearance.

 

Not to mention that the Emperor’s figure could not be seen at all. Could it be that he had already…

 

Everyone, both those watching the video and present at the scene, was in a state of panic. Some were sending messages requesting military support, while others completely could not believe it and thought it was special effects. The remaining people were furiously cursing about what exactly was going on, why so many people were blatantly attempting to assassinate the Emperor, where were the precautions? Where was the guard squad? What was Ryan doing!

 

The live broadcast had not been interrupted, and those far away could only stare fixedly at the screen, wanting to know the crux of the matter and the Emperor’s safety.

 

The performers below the stage had solemn expressions, and even when facing the guard squad, they were able to launch coordinated attacks, clearly having undergone long-term training.

 

In such a situation, the guard squad did not have large-scale lethal weapons, and they were being beaten back by the opponent’s powerful firepower.

 

In the live broadcast, people’s worries and fears had all transformed into fury, with comment after comment cursing the royal guard squad. They were supposed to be the most outstanding talents selected from the military, yet they were being beaten back step by step by a ragtag group. It was too ridiculous and shameful.

 

The performers below continued their assault, their weapons having abundant energy sources, and the guard squad was no match for them.

 

But in the next moment, the weapons in their hands all dropped to the ground. These people’s expressions turned agonized, wailing as they clutched their heads, as if suffering immense torture, rolling on the ground.

 

Alvia slowly emerged through the smoke, appearing before the audience’s bated breath in the live broadcast. The gray dust separated from his body, leaving not a speck of dust on his black military uniform. He looked down at the wailing people below, not saying anything, only giving a slight glance, and the guard squad, which had just been beaten back, immediately surrounded those below the stage.

 

The easily attainable victory was effortlessly reversed. Before anyone could react to what had happened, the guard squad had dragged away each of the rebellious individuals rolling in agony on the ground.

 

The comments were all asking what had happened, with this year’s founding ceremony being truly too dangerous.

 

Ryan, who had been beaten to a pulp earlier, had arrived at Alvia’s side at some unknown point and whispered something. Everyone only saw the Emperor give a slight nod.

 

As the smoke cleared, Alvia returned to his seat once more. If not for the surroundings in disarray, his expression looked as if nothing had happened, cold and fearless.

 

Ryan nodded towards the distance, and a huge light screen suddenly appeared where the performers had been standing below the stage. The light screen flickered a few times, and a large face appeared on it.

 

Those watching the light screen in the live broadcast were filled with confusion, feeling that their intelligence seemed inadequate for the day.

 

And the person who appeared on the light screen was none other than the long-unseen Heya.

 

As he had always been working as a mercenary, few people recognized Heya, and upon seeing him now, they only felt that this person’s stature seemed too tall.

 

“Your Majesty, the people have been captured, and all evidence, both material and personal, is present. The treasonous information that the Sharp Family head had destroyed has been restored, and all evidence related to their attempted usurpation has been found.”

 

Alvia nodded.

 

Heya glanced at the light screen, and with one look at the ravaged ground, it was clear what had happened.

 

He also saw the cameras flying around, directly facing him, so he spoke directly to the camera: “The assassination attempts from a few days ago and today were both carried out by the Sharp Family. We currently have evidence of all their crimes. Please do not worry, the Emperor will not be harmed, and Duke Xelance is also fine. With Zeus’s help, we had already grasped their plot long ago. It was only because the Sharp Family head was too deeply hidden that we only found his hiding place today.”

 

After speaking, Heya saluted Alvia and then turned off the light screen.

 

On the other side, the “deceased” Duke Xelance, who had just “died,” was sitting in his original seat, smiling and waving at everyone. The bloodstain had soaked a large area of his clothes, yet he appeared to have no issues. Afterwards, Duke Xelance seemed to feel uncomfortable and took out a nearly empty blood pack from his chest.

 

“……”

 

“I don’t know what to say anymore, I thought the Empire was going to change rulers, I was scared to death.”

 

“It’s good that the Emperor is fine.”

 

“I was just cursing the guard squad, so… was it all an act?”

 

“I just saw a member of the guard squad get injured and fall, his comrade was holding him with a grieving expression, but now the two of them are together, carrying away the rebels, and were clearly uninjured, it was all an act.”

 

“The Sharp Family? They really have had enough of living, ignoring the good life to cause such a mess.”

 

“They deserved it, no one in their family is a good person.”

 

“Wuwuwu, my legs are still shaking, the Emperor is too formidable, to come through such a fierce attack without a scratch.”

 

“You’ve forgotten the Emperor’s valor on the battlefield in previous years. I think these nobles have had too much of the good life and are just looking for trouble.”

 

The singer who had presented the Xenian feathered accessory seemed to have been forgotten by everyone, and even his fans did not dare speak up, unable to imagine that their beloved little angel was actually a rebel, and had even tried to assassinate the Emperor in full view of everyone. Fortunately, he had not succeeded.

 

Alvia had known about today’s farce long ago, and it could have been prevented earlier, but the Sharp Family had hidden too deeply, and Heya had been unable to find them for a time. Fearing that preemptive prevention would scare them away, this had happened.

 

Fortunately, Heya did not disappoint, finding the Sharp Family head’s hiding place and capturing him, as well as discovering evidence of their crimes.

 

The founding ceremony then proceeded normally, with Alvia sitting on the ravaged stage, amidst the dust-covered surroundings. A golden chair shone brilliantly, and Alvia, clad in a black military uniform and seated on the chair, was the most striking presence amidst the dust.

 

The nobles and ministers also acted as if nothing had happened, returning to their positions. Some remained unruffled, smiling faintly without a word, while others had stiff smiles, and yet others could not even maintain their expressions, overwhelmed with panic.

 

All reckoning would come after today. For now, everyone’s thoughts differed as they accompanied the ruler in watching the remaining program. The two previous farces had concluded, and the real performance had only just begun.

 

*

 

In the game world.

 

Zhou Zhou had learned a lot about Zeus from him and also knew that people nowadays were very accepting of the unknown and would not eliminate him just for being different.

 

He looked at Zeus and finally made up his mind.

 

“Zeus, I want to tell you something. Can you help me keep it a secret? Don’t tell anyone else for now.”

 

Zeus immediately perked up. A secret just between him and Zhou Zhou?

 

What were Alvia’s few flowers worth? He now shared a secret with Zhou Zhou, and it was clear at a glance who was closer. Let’s see Alvia be smug about that.

 

Zeus couldn’t help but grin: “Sure, sure, I’ll definitely keep it a secret for you.”
